    An (amazingly simple) aperiodic monotile has been discovered by David Smith, Joseph Myers (@jsm28), Craig Kaplan (@csk), and Chaim Goodman-Strauss. It&amp;#39;s literally four copies of a third of a hexagon glued together. Details at https://cs.uwaterloo.ca/~csk/hat/
